Bluetongue (Blue tongue) confirmed on third farm

A fourth case of bluetongue disease has been confirmed on a farm in Ipswich, near Suffolk, according to DEFRA.
This is now the third farm to have tested positive for the disease and the animal has since been culled.
Commenting on the confirmation of a fourth case of bluetongue in the UK, shadow environment secretary, Peter Ainsworth said:
“The news for British farming seems to get worse every day. This latest finding of bluetongue is ominous even though it is not entirely unexpected.
“After four confirmed cases, the Government should now make clear on what basis they will declare an official outbreak of bluetongue.”
